当前位置:主页 > 科技论文 > 航空航天论文 >

面向航天器仿真分析的高性能计算应用模式研究

发布时间:2020-08-13 15:57
【摘要】:仿真计算资源成本的投入逐渐成为企业成本投入的重中之重,其仅次于人力资源成本投入。虽然购置了高性能的计算设备,但却无法保障设备的充分利用,使得企业竞争能力明显不足。本文以航天器制造企业为项目背景,结合资源调度系统LSF,以构建高性能计算环境,优化作业调度算法,提升系统资源利用率为出发点,研究如何在最小化任务集时间跨度的同时兼顾计算资源负载均衡的问题。作业调度算法的选取是作业调度的关键,Min-Min算法作为经典的启发式调度算法,常被用作标准算法来评估其他算法,本文基于Min-Min算法开展了进一步的研究。首先,对Min-Min算法进行了较为详细的研究和分析。它的基本思想是优先执行具有最小的最早完成时间的计算任务,从而实现单个任务的执行时间最短,其本质上是一种贪心算法。但由于贪心算法的缺陷,使得当前做出的选择有可能是局部最优解,算法为了实现最小化最小完成时间的目标,有时需要将任务分配到具有较长执行时间的计算节点上,造成总体的时间跨度增加。同时,该算法优先将任务映射给计算能力最强的计算资源,造成计算能力强的计算资源负载过重,计算能力弱的计算资源较为空闲,整体计算资源负载不均,导致资源利用率较低。其次,针对上述不足,本文对Min-Min算法进行了改进,提出一种基于标准差的最小最早完成时间算法(SDMM,Standard Deviation Min-Min)。在制造行业,集群系统往往分阶段建设,因此计算环境具有一定的差异性和异构性,任务在不同处理机的执行时间具有较大差异。本文采用任务执行时间标准差来衡量不同处理机间的差异以及任务对于负载均衡的影响度。算法在综合考量最小完成时间和任务执行时间标准差的基础上进行调度,兼顾了高吞吐率和负载均衡,更适应生产环境的异构性。最后,通过GridSim模拟器对Min-Min算法、Dpri-Min-Min算法、Proposed算法和SDMM算法进行了模拟对比分析,结果表明SDMM算法相比其他三种算法有一定的提高,保留了原有算法的高性能,同时有效的实现了负载均衡,提高了许可证资源利用率,满足航天器仿真分析过程中对于成本控制和资源精益化利用的实际需求。因此,面向航天器仿真分析的高性能应用模式研究、调度算法研究,对于航空、航天等大型制造企业,具有一定的借鉴意义。
【学位授予单位】:南京理工大学
【学位级别】:硕士
【学位授予年份】:2018
【分类号】:V411.8
【图文】:

主机,小型机,制造业,航天器


图1.1某航天器制造业某研[偸以怂阕试词关酵掣煎义匣廖常埠耍茫校铡ⅲ玻担叮悄冢罚啃⌒突衿鳎骰挛埠耍茫校眨澹叮矗牵伦髡荆赏伎梢钥闯觯杓剖κ非阆颍辏渴褂酶遾\0K机,I?:机A的Load邋av日一直处于1.0以上,甚至到达4.0,长期处于严?超载m觯骰

本文编号:2792211

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/hangkongsky/2792211.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户d5b35***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com